You get the Champion bag, which is needed for PvP equipment. Actually you can choose between a Champion bag or a Battlemaster bag, but to open the Battlemaster one you need to be PvP Rank 60. (So hitting R60 is quite a big deal, and that's why so many were freaking out yesterday.)
In the Champion bag you can find 3 Centurion Commendations (needed to buy Centurion grade pvp items (tier 1), which is the common chance, or a random piece of Champion grade pvp item (tier 2), which is the uncommon chance, roughly 1 out of 5. The stupid part here is that you can get the same uncommon item over and over, and you can't do shit with it: you can't trade it, you can't even redeem it for some more Centurion commendations. Basically, if you for example got the uber rare Champion weapon, and then you find another Champion weapon, you are gonna do nothing with it, and you didn't even get the Centurion commendations you could have gotten, since you either get 3 commendations or the Champion random piece and 1 commendation.
The Battlemaster bags have been changed with last patch so while much harder to get them, you don't risk to get double pieces as they have either Champion commendations (used to buy tier 2 items), or Battlemaster commendations, much rarer but used to buy any BM gear without the risk of doubles.
So yeah, basically pvp dailies and weeklies are the ONLY way to get Battlemaster bags (hence Battlemaster gear) and the best way to get Champion bags outside of the 800 Warzone commendations needed to buy one. This is because Champion bags can be purchased, Battlemaster bags are only quest rewards. The weekly gives you 3 Champion bags or 2 Battlemaster bags. The Daily gives you 1 Champion bag or 1 Battlemaster bag.
Bottom line: while it's slow but theoretically possible to get tier 1 and 2 pvp equipment without ever doing the dailies/weeklies, you can't get tier 3 without completing them.
